purchase order management involves several key steps, starting with the creation of a purchase order. A purchase order is a document issued by a buyer to a seller, indicating the details of the goods or services to be purchased, quantity, price, payment terms, and delivery date. It serves as a legal document that formalizes the buyer’s intent to purchase and the seller’s commitment to deliver the goods or services as specified.

Once a purchase order is generated, it needs to be sent to the supplier for confirmation and processing. This can be done manually through email or fax, or electronically through a dedicated purchase order management system. Electronic purchase order systems offer numerous advantages, such as automatic transmission, tracking, and integration with other business systems like inventory management and accounting software. This streamlines the entire procurement process and reduces the risk of errors and delays.

Another key component of purchase order management is invoice reconciliation. After goods or services are delivered, businesses need to match the supplier’s invoice with the corresponding purchase order to verify the accuracy of charges. This process can be time-consuming and prone to errors if done manually. However, with a purchase order management system, invoices can be automatically matched against purchase orders, flagged for discrepancies, and reconciled in a timely manner. This not only saves time and effort but also helps prevent overpayments, duplicate charges, and billing errors.
